Some of yall really dont know sausage casing lol. A hank will make approximately 100 lbs of sausage. A hank cost roughly $20 and thats me buying it by the 5 gallon bucket. You can buy the small packs for around $5 at most grocery stores but it isn't close to a hank and its generally much shorter pieces and a smaller diameter casing. Ideally for sausage a 32-35mm casing works best but for Boudin or Andouille you can go larger.
